What makes a generation outage different
An outage window is usually fixed before the work is fully scoped. The unit comes offline on a date set by grid commitments and comes back on a date that is not negotiable. Everything else bends around that.
The cost of delay is measured in hours
Lost generation revenue accrues by the hour, not the day. That compresses every decision cycle and makes a daily cost picture the minimum useful cadence.
Long-lead components dominate the risk
Turbine components, generator parts, and heat exchanger elements carry lead times measured in months and sometimes in quarters. A single mis-located component can consume the float in an entire outage window.
Documentation is a deliverable, not overhead
Regulatory and reliability documentation has to be produced as work happens. Reconstructing it after the fact is expensive and, in some cases, not acceptable.

Answers people search for.
Does this handle regulatory documentation?
Work packages carry procedures, permits, photographs, and completion records as the work happens, so the documentation is produced during the outage rather than reassembled after it.
Can it track long-lead components specifically?
Yes. Long-lead items are tracked from requisition through receipt and yard location, with shortages mapped onto the P6 schedule activities they threaten.
Does it work for both planned and forced outages?
The product is built for planned outages. Forced outage scope can be added to an existing event, but the planning workflow assumes a planned window.
How does it fit with our existing outage schedule?
P6 stays authoritative. EZTRAK reads activity dates and reports material and cost against them.
Can we start with one module?
Yes. Most clients start with one and add the others after it has been through an outage.
